CAR SELLING TIPS

Selling a car on your own is one way to make sure you get what it's really worth. The reality is that you won't necessarily get the true value of your car if you trade it in at a dealership. After all, the dealership needs to make money, too. They offer you less money, so they have room to mark it up.

By selling it yourself, you can make up to $1,000 to $2,000 more of the sale. But selling your car to a dealership has its advantages. They will handle everything for you so all you need to do is pickup the check.

Selling to a dealership is often a better option for some people as they can sell there car in hours vs selling it privately may take months, cost of advertising, working around your schedule to show your car etc.

Either way you choose to sell your car make the most of of it by making sure you get the car in the best possible shape. A little bit of hard work can really pay off.

Exterior

  • Wash the entire car when preparing for selling a car. Rinse off the car first. Next, gently wash it with an automotive cleaner and a soft sponge or wash mitt. Don't use dish detergent -- it can be harmful to your paint. Be sure to rinse as you wash, too, so the soap does not dry on your car. Dry the car with a clean, soft towel.
  • Next, focus on the tires. You can use WD-40 on the wheel wells by spraying it on, letting it dry, and then wiping it off. You can use a household degreaser to clean the tires, rims and hubcaps. A little elbow grease can really improve the looks of your tires.
  • Also, don't forget to wax your car to give the exterior that polished look. When you're selling a car, the first impression of the outside can make a huge difference.

Interior

  • Cleaning out your car is a must. The first thing you should do is clean out the junk. Throw away trash and anything else that you've been storing in your car. Dig down into the seats to remove all of the food, change and miscellaneous items that have accumulated.
  • Next, wipe down and condition all of the surfaces inside your car. This will give the interior a nice, clean look.
  • Using a window cleaner, clean all of the windows, both inside and out. Don't forget to clean the mirrors, too.
  • Finally, thoroughly vacuuming the interior is important when selling a car. Vacuum not just the carpets, but also the seats and crevices. Try a carpet cleaner to remove any spots or stains.

Miscellaneous

  • Be sure all fluids are topped off.
  • Check the air in the tires, and add some, if necessary.
  • Make sure any lights or fuses that have burnt out are replaced.
  • Remove any bumper stickers on the car.
